Tuto otázku nám kladete znovu a znovu. URL s lomítkem na konci měly původně sloužit k označování adresářů, zatímco adresy bez lomítka na konci měly označovat soubory:http://example.com/foo/ (se závěrečným lomítkem, obvyklé označení adresáře) http://example.com/foo (bez závěrečného lomítka, obvyklé označení souboru) Toto rozlišení se však dnes často nedodržuje. Google považuje obě URL za samostatné (a rovnocenné), ať už se jedná o soubor nebo adresář či zda adresa obsahuje na konci lomítko nebo ne.Různý obsah URL s lomítkem a bez něj – Googlu nevadí, uživatelům přidělá vrásky Z čistě technického hlediska je pro vyhledávač bez problémů přijatelné, když dvě téměř shodné verze URL obsahují různý obsah. Uživatelům však tato konfigurace může dokonale zamotat hlavu. Jen si představte, že byste na stránkách www.google.com/webmasters a www.google.com/webmasters/ našli úplně jiný obsah. Z toho důvodu mají obvykle URL s lomítkem i bez něj identický obsah.Konfigurace a možnosti nastavení stránek Na svých stránkách si můžete rychle vyzkoušet, jak se zachovají následující URL:Zkuste, zda obě verze vrátí obsah (s HTTP kódem 200 ) nebo se jedna verze přesměruje na druhou. Ideálním chováním je zobrazit jedinou verzi (tj. jedna adresa vrací obsah a druhá adresa uživatele přesměruje). Takové chování je výhodné i proto, že snižuje množství duplicitního obsahu . V konkrétním případě přesměrování na URL s lomítkem na konci se ve výsledcích vyhledávání pravděpodobně zobrazí verze URL s kódem odpovědi 200 (většinou jde o URL s lomítkem) – bez ohledu na to, zda kód přesměrování byl 301 nebo 302. Pokud verze s lomítkem na konci i bez něj budou obě obsahovat stejný obsah a obě vrátí kód 200, můžete postupovat takto: Zvažte, zda je možné změnit stávající chování stránek (další informace níže), aby se snížilo množství duplicitního obsahu a zvýšila se efektivita procházení. Ponechejte stávající řešení. Duplicitní obsah se nachází na řadě stránek. Proces indexování často řeší podobné případy namísto webmasterů a uživatelů. A i když nejde o zcela optimální chování, je plně legitimní a v pořádku. :) Pokud jde konkrétně o kořenové URL vašich stránek, ujišťujeme vás, že adresa http://example.com je zcela ekvivalentní s adresou http://example.com/ a nepřesměruje ji ani Chuck Norris. Kroky pro poskytování jediné verze URL Jak postupovat v případě, že vaše stránky obsahují duplicitní obsah na následujících dvou URL: Co dělat, když obě URL vrací kód 200 (a u žádné z nich není nastaveno přesměrování ani neobsahuje parametr rel=”canonical ”) a vy chcete tuto situaci změnit? Zvolte si preferovanou verzi URL. Pokud vaše stránky používají adresářovou strukturu, je obvyklejší používat u URL adresářů lomítko na konci (např. example.com/adresář/ spíše než example.com/adresář ), ale můžete si zvolit libovolnou možnost. Používejte konzistentně preferovanou verzi. Zadávejte ji ve svých interních odkazech. Pokud používáte soubory Sitemap , uveďte v ní preferovanou verzi (a neuvádějte duplicitní URL). Duplicitní URL přesměrujte na preferovanou verzi pomocí HTTP přesměrování s kódem 301. Pokud to není možné, dalším dobrým řešením je použití parametru rel=”canonical”. Parametr rel=”canonical” funguje při indexování Googlem i ostatními velkými vyhledávači podobně jako přesměrování 301. Konfiguraci přesměrování 301 můžete otestovat pomocí nástroje Načíst jako Googlebot v Nástrojích pro webmastery . Zkontrolujte, zda se následující URL chovají podle očekávání: http://example.com/foo/ http://example.com/foo Preferovaná verze by měla vrátit kód 200. Duplicitní URL by se měla prostřednictvím kódu 301 přesměrovat na preferovanou URL. V Nástrojích pro webmastery zkontrolujte chyby při procházení , a je-li to možné, také log soubory na vašem webovém serveru pro kontrolu správné implementace přesměrování 301. A je to! Může vás hřát vědomí, že máte efektivně nastavený server, a těšit myšlenka, že vaše stránky jsou lépe optimalizované. Maile Ohye, technický vedoucí vývojářských programů Zodpovědný za překlad: Jan Macek, tým Kvality vyhledávaní
4 komentáře :
Bohužel špatně zafungovalo escapování znaků a v sekci Konfigurace a možnosti nastavení stránek to ukazuje
1. http://// (s lomítkem na konci)
2. http:/// (bez lomítka na konci)
místo
1. http://nazev-vasi-domeny/nazev-adresare/ (s lomítkem na konci)
2. http://nazev-vasi-domeny/nazev-adresare (bez lomítka na konci)
Zajímavé, psal jsem o tom v sobotu. http://www.netzin.cz/clanky/google-lomitka-na-konci-url
Nějak se nám ty články během posledního týdne sešly: http://phpfashion.com/jsou-tyto-url-stejne
Jen dodám, že Google opravdu nevadí, pokud je různý obsah na URL s lomítkem a bez něj, ale jde asi o jediného z velkých vyhledávačů, který to umí rozlišit.
Díky Jakube za upozornění na nezobarazování všech znaků.
Okomentovat